| 1. DATE - TIME GROUP | 2. LOCATION | | --- | --- | | 2 September 50 02/0024Z | Ernest Harmon AFB, Newfoundland | | 3. SOURCE | 10. CONCLUSION | | Military | INSUFFICIENT DATA FOR EVALUATION | | 4. NUMBER OF OBJECTS | | | One | | | 5. LENGTH OF OBSERVATION | 11. BRIEF SUMMARY AND ANALYSIS | | Not Reported | Observer was on east end of runway when he noticed silhouette of a person between beach and self. When observer investigated saw flash and felt hand burn. | | 6. TYPE OF OBSERVATION | Ground-Visual | | 7. COURSE | East | | 8. PHOTOS | ☐ Yes ☑ No | | 9. PHYSICAL EVI…
